HMRC Embraces New Technologies
In a bid to be more in tune with UK citizens, HM Revenue and Customs are increasingly using new technologies as they strive to keep us updated with changes in legislation, online filing and much more. They have a blog which is updated regularly and also a Twitter page.
Their most recent addition is the podcast. HMRC have recorded a series of podcasts and the latest one is aimed at businesses and citizens throughout the UK including contractors and sole traders.
The ‘Super’ podcast as it has been named, features guidance from HMRC experts including Stephen Banyard and also Don Macarthur. It covers important topics such as; the need for all employers to file their Employer Annual Returns online from this spring; new penalties for late payment of PAYE being introduced in May; and key changes to corporation tax filing and payment coming in next year.
Stephen Banyard, director of HMRC’s Business Customer Unit, said: “Our Super Podcast is a great way for businesses to remind themselves about some of the major changes on the horizon affecting VAT, PAYE and corporation tax. So whether you’re a VAT-registered trader, employer or limited company, we’d urge you to take 15 minutes to download and listen to it, to help ensure you’re prepared for the changes.”
